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Melton Mowbray to Blackheath start from as little as £16.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Melton Mowbray to Blackheath start from £81.10 one way, or £84.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Melton Mowbray to Blackheath are available for £100.40 one way, or £200.80 return

Facilities and Accessibility at Melton Mowbray Station

Melton Mowbray station caters to a variety of needs to make your rail journey comfortable. Ticket availability is straightforward, with an office open from 6:45 to 13:40 on weekdays and Saturdays. If you're purchasing tickets online, rest assured you can collect them at the station, although accessible ticket machines are not available. The station has an induction loop and smartcard validators as well. Though facilities like CCTV are present for safety, the absence of staff assistance might necessitate planning for travelers requiring additional support. Fortunately, some step-free access is available, primarily to platform 1.

For those with accessibility needs, Melton Mowbray might present some challenges. While accessible toilets are provided, options such as waiting rooms and seating areas are limited. The car park, operated by East Midlands Railway, offers 68 spaces with 3 dedicated accessible spaces, but no accessible taxis are available. You can easily pay by using RingGo, and the parking charges are straightforward with options ranging from daily to annual passes.

Onward Travel and Connections

Getting to and from Melton Mowbray is a breeze with multiple transport links available. For short distances, several local taxi services operate nearby, including Mowbray and Manor. If you're seeking public transport, there’s ample bus information conveniently available online. For those infrequent times when rail replacement services are in operation, they are conveniently located right outside the station.

The station is well-connected for those who wish to combine cycling with their journey. While there is no cycle hire facility, secure bicycle storage with 32 spaces is available, safeguarded with CCTV coverage. Take note: the bicycle storage lacks shelters, so you might need to prepare for unpredictable British weather!

Connectivity and Accessibility

Blackheath station boasts partial step-free access, with platform 1 featuring a lift for services heading towards London, and platform 2 accessible via a ramp for services departing from London. An induction loop and accessible ticket machines help ensure that those with hearing and mobility needs are catered for. A meeting point is conveniently located at the ticket office or you may opt to use the help point for assistance. While luggage storage is absent, the station does ensure safety and security with CCTV surveillance.

Essential Amenities

Grabbing a quick bite or a hot drink is effortless with a coffee kiosk and vending machines right at the station. An ATM is also present near the ticket office for any last-minute cash withdrawals. However, those in need of currency exchange services will need to seek these elsewhere as they are not available at the station. If you plan on cycling to or from Blackheath, you will find ample bicycle storage on Platforms 1 and 2, complete with shelters, albeit without CCTV protection.

Onward Travel Options

Finding your way beyond the train station is facilitated by various transport links. The station is well-served by local bus services, with stops conveniently positioned near the Railway Tavern. Taxis are also readily available, making it easy to get mobile for those trips not covered by rail. In the unfortunate event of service disruptions, a rail replacement service to Charlton or Kidbrooke is accessible from Route 89 bus stop D, with services towards Lewisham from bus stop E.
